THE NURBURGRING-ASTRA by WRAPworks


A total of 835 vehicles of the Nurburgring Edition produced between April

2004 and November 2010 of the Opel Astra with the index letter H have left

the Opel Performance Center – better known as OPC in Russelsheim – in the

year 2008.

The number 835 in turn was not arbitrarily determined, rather it is a homage

to the lap time of 8:35 minutes, which was set by Manuel REUTER with his

Opel Astra H OPC at the Nordschleife of the Nurburgring. The number 56 of

this series with two liters displacement and 240 hp turbo (= 176 kW) is to

be discussed here.


However, let us take a closer look at the outer appearance of the ring star.

The upcoming firm WRAPworks from Engelskirchen, which is situated somewhere

between Cologne and Olpe, has chosen such compact class Opel. The crew

around Timo LOHMEIER has deepened the theme “Nurburgring Edition” and

adjusted the design to it accordingly. The foil colors – titan-metallic mat

as well as high-gloss red – have been chosen to match the factory logo. To

realize the exclusive foliation and to foil every detail the car has been

largely disassembled into its component parts. A high-gloss digital printing

in carbon style was specially made for the engine hood to accentuate the

logo.

And the brute sound delivering exhaust system by Remus with the centered

tailpipe is perfectly accentuated by means of the red line ending on it. To

preserve the relation to the original Nurburg Edition, the series checks

have been left on the bonnet, top and tailgate, at least partially. The

price for this really exclusive WRAPworks-foliation is at 1.250,00 Euros and

it is realizable within two working days. So much to the Astra’s “designer

outfit”.


It goes almost without saying that the number 56 had also to stand some

changes. The Astra H OPC is lowered by means of EIBACH-30/30 springs. The

exhaust system from turbo is usually installed on the sister model Vauxhall

Astra VXR and it comes from REMUS. This Nurburgring-Astra has an OPC 1 brake

cooling and yellow fog lights. Also an adjustable Whiteline-rear

axle-stabilizer and a Pipercross air filter are installed. The Courtenay PU

motor bearing and the bronze bushings for the guide pins of the ATE-break

calipers at the front axle are also worth mentioning, which ensure a higher

pressure point and prevent an oblique wear of the lining. The very important

part of the connection between car and road take the rims called Nitro by

Motec in 8×18 ET30, which are tired with Hankook Ventus V12 in 225/40ZR18.

Finally the rear wiper was removed and Rally-4-safety belts by SCHROTH were

installed inside. By the way, this car is regularly running on the

Nordschleife and quite often it makes some larger caliber looking silly,

just to mention.
